The Department of Energy (DOE), through the Office of Science in the Biological and Environmental Research (BER) program, issued this discretionary research grant opportunity called "Earth System Model Development and Analysis" (Funding Opportunity Number DE FOA 0002230). It is designed to support science and technology research and development that strengthens the nation s ability to model and simulate the Earth system, with an emphasis on improving how well we can predict changes across a wide range of time horizons and geographic scales. The program sits within BER s Earth and Environmental Systems Modeling (EESM) portfolio, which focuses on advancing the modeling tools and computational approaches used to represent complex interactions among the atmosphere, land, oceans, ice, ecosystems, and related environmental processes.
At its core, the opportunity targets projects that develop and demonstrate advanced Earth system modeling and simulation capabilities. That means applicants are generally expected to push beyond incremental updates and instead contribute meaningful improvements in model components, coupled system behavior, or analysis methods that raise predictive skill. The DOE frames the motivation in two connected ways: first, to deepen scientific understanding of how the natural world works and how it is evolving; and second, to produce practical, decision-relevant information that can support planning and risk management for energy assets and infrastructure. In other words, better Earth system predictability is positioned not only as a scientific goal but also as a foundation for anticipating environmental conditions that can affect energy production, transmission, water availability, and infrastructure resilience.
This is a grant program (Funding Instrument Type: Grant) under CFDA 81.049, and eligibility is listed as unrestricted, meaning it is broadly open to a wide range of applicant types, subject to any additional eligibility language that may appear in the full announcement. The FOA was created on December 17, 2019, with an original application deadline of March 31, 2020. DOE anticipated making around 10 awards, with an award ceiling of $900,000 per award, indicating a portfolio-style competition where multiple projects could be supported at moderate research scale rather than a single large center award.
